软件开发领域日益呈现出多样化的趋势。表格作为一种重要的数据存储和展示方式,在软件开发中扮演着举足轻重的角色。本文将从表格在现代软件开发中的应用、表格代码实现以及优化策略等方面进行探讨,以期为软件开发者提供有益的参考。
一、表格在现代软件开发中的应用
1. 数据存储与查询
表格是数据库中常用的数据存储结构,具有结构化、易于查询等特点。在软件开发中,表格广泛应用于数据存储、查询和统计等方面。例如,在电子商务平台中,商品信息、订单信息等数据可以通过表格进行存储和查询。
2. 数据展示与交互
表格在数据展示和交互方面具有独特的优势。在Web前端开发中,表格常用于展示用户信息、商品信息等数据。表格还支持与用户的交互操作,如排序、筛选等,提高了用户体验。
3. 数据分析
表格是数据分析的重要工具。通过对表格数据的挖掘和分析,可以发现数据中的规律和趋势,为决策提供依据。在商业智能、大数据等领域,表格发挥着重要作用。
4. 代码生成与维护
表格可以简化代码生成过程,提高开发效率。在数据库设计阶段,可以通过表格生成相应的数据访问层代码。表格还可以帮助开发者快速定位和修复代码中的错误。
二、表格代码实现
1. 数据库设计
在软件开发过程中,首先需要对数据库进行设计。根据业务需求,确定数据表结构、字段类型、索引等信息。常用的数据库设计工具包括PowerDesigner、MySQL Workbench等。
2. 数据库操作
数据库操作包括数据的增删改查等。在Java、Python等编程语言中,可以使用JDBC、ORM等技术实现数据库操作。以下是一个使用JDBC技术实现数据查询的示例代码:
```java
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Exception;
public class DatabaseQuery {
public static void main(String[] args) {
Connection conn = null;
PreparedStatement pstmt = null;
ResultSet rs = null;
try {
// 加载数据库驱动
Class.forName(\